Wyoming Small Businesses Lead in AI Adoption, Report Finds.

The U.S. Chamber’s Empowering Small Business report shows 65% of Wyoming small businesses use an AI platform, 47% use generative AI chatbots, 82% expect AI to help growth, and 55% use cryptocurrency.

Wyoming's Laramie County Approves 10GW Data Center Campus.

Laramie County commissioners unanimously voted to build a data center campus designed to scale to 10 gigawatts.

Microsoft’s 3,200-acre Cheyenne data center expansion raises water, power, jobs questions.

Microsoft announced plans to purchase roughly 3,200 acres in southeast Cheyenne for a major data center expansion, raising questions about jobs, development, and regional water and power use.

Wyoming County Approves Construction of Massive Data Center.

A Wyoming county has approved the construction of Project Jade, a data center expected to become the largest in the US, with a potential electricity demand equivalent to 10 nuclear plants.
